Tornado Struck Brighton Tuesday Night

According to the National Weather Service, the tornado had winds up to 80 mph and cut a path 0.3 miles wide and 2.8 miles long.

A tornado touched down in Brighton late Tuesday night, according to the National Weather Service.

The service posted on Twitter Wednesday that an EF0 tornado, the lowest on the measurement scale, started on Brighton Road between Timberbend Drive and Bauer Road and traveled southeast and ended between Wells and Hamburg roads.
